One of the most common issues that can arise with uPVC windows is that they become difficult to open or lock. This problem usually occurs when the locking system has become stiff or stuck. If this is the case, an easy fix is to use graphite powder or machine oil to lubricate the handle and lock mechanism. This will enable the mechanism to be freed up and allow the window or door to function normally again.
Another issue that can be found with uPVC windows is that the hinges get stiff or even stuck. This issue is typically caused by grit and dust building on the hinges. The solution is to lubricate the hinges using grease or oil. A poor lubricant could damage the hinges and make them inoperable.

Stained Glass Repairs
Stained glass windows are stunning designs for churches, homes and other structures. They can add visual interest and provide privacy to a room. They can be fragile and require regular maintenance to ensure they are in good condition. Even with the most careful maintenance, stained glass and leaded windows can become damaged due to age, exposure to the elements and weather factors. This can cause cracks, fading, or water leakage. It is important to locate an expert local to restore your stained or stained window to its original glory.
The cost of repairing cracked or broken stained-glass is $500. The exact price will depend on the kind of solution needed to fix the issue. A professional may use copper foil or epoxy edge-gluing to repair the broken glasses. They can also relead lead and repair stained glass. There are a variety of options available and each one has advantages and disadvantages. The selection of the most suitable solution will be determined by the size of the crack, its location, and the type of material used in the production of the glass.
Leaded glass cracks could be caused by vibrations, thermal expansion or contraction and building movements, or just normal wear and tear. Over time, the cracks could grow and cause more problems. A crack across an important area or on the surface of a stained glass panel should be repaired as soon as is possible to avoid further expansion and damage. In the past, this was typically done by splicing in a "Dutchman" lead flange on top of the crack. This method was not a great solution, and now there are better ways to repair these types of cracks.
Stained glass restoration is a highly skilled art that can take a variety of forms. It can be as easy as fixing cracks, or as complex as restoring an entire stained glass door or window panel back to its original condition. Generally speaking, the price of restoration projects is much higher than replacing or repairing a damaged piece. This is because the project involves cleaning and removing damaged or soiled glass, securing the lead cames, sealing and re-tying the cement, and replacing missing pieces of stained glass.
Weatherstripping Repairs
Weatherstripping prevents water and air from coming into homes through the gaps between windows and doors. It's a crucial part of home maintenance and can reduce the need for costly repairs or energy bills, as in making homes more comfortable. However the materials used to create this seal can deteriorate as time passes due to wear and tear, which makes it essential to replace the seals from time to time.
You can detect whether your weather stripping has worn out by noticing a wet spot after washing the windows, a whistling noise when driving down the road, or a draft that you feel in front of a closed-door. Taskers can employ a variety of weatherstripping materials to seal your doors and windows. Foam tapes are composed from closed cell or upvc Window repairs near me open-cell foam. They are available in a variety of sizes, thicknesses, and widths. They are simple to install and cut with scissors. Felt strips are also inexpensive and usually last for a year or two. You can cut them to size using scissors, and then attach them to the frame of your door, hinge side, or sliding window using staples, glue, or tacks. Metal or vinyl V strips are a bit more difficult to set up, but can be attached to the window jamb.
